Research Associate-Fixed Term

Michigan State University is seeking a Research Associate for the Decision Analysis and Support Lab within the Department of Fisheries and Wildlife. The role involves co-leading the development of decision-making processes for Cisco restoration in Lake Erie and collaborating with fisheries managers to evaluate stocking strategies and restoration actions.

Responsibilities

Co-lead collaborative workshops with agency partners to iteratively develop and refine a decision prototype for Cisco restoration in Lake Erie
Integrate research products from the Coregonine Restoration Framework to predict management outcomes and identify (or pursue) expanded analyses to support the decision analysis
Develop predictive decision analysis to determine optimal allocation of management actions (e.g., stocking) and optimization analyses under various uncertainties
Support the development of implementation and adaptive management plans for Cisco restoration in Lake Erie that also align with the Coregonine Restoration Framework
Lead the development of manuscripts focused on decision analytic tools (e.g., multi-criteria decision analysis, risk analysis, value of information) and the Coregonine Restoration Framework
Collaborate on other projects within the DAS Lab that align with research and professional development interests
